浮動小数点数 Floating-point numbers は、3.14159 や 0.1-273.15 のような、小数部を持つ数です。

浮動小数点型は、整数の型よりも幅広い範囲の値を表現し、Int に保存できるよりも大きい、または小さい値を保存できます。Swift には、2 種類の符号付き浮動小数点数型があります。

  • Double は、64 ビット浮動小数点数になります。
  • Float は、32 ビット浮動小数点数になります。
NOTE
Double は、少なくとも 15 桁の精度を持ち、Float は 6 桁の精度になります。適切な浮動小数点型は、コードで扱う必要がある値の範囲によります。どちらの型も適している状況では、Double を利用するようにします。

Portions of this page are translations based on work created and shared by Apple and used according to terms described in the Creative Commons Attribution 4.0 International License.